انجمن‌های فارسی اوبونتو

لطفاً به انجمن‌ها وارد شده و یا جهت ورود ثبت‌نام نمائید

لطفاً جهت ورود نام کاربری و رمز عبورتان را وارد نمائید


توزیع گنو/لینوکس اوبونتو ۲۰ ساله شد 🎉

نویسنده موضوع: حذف کامل نرم افزار از روی سیستم(حل شد)  (دفعات بازدید: 3500 بار)

0 کاربر و 1 مهمان درحال مشاهده موضوع.

آفلاین x

  • High Sr. Member
  • *
  • ارسال: 561
  • جنسیت : پسر
سلام دوستان
میخوام یک برنامه را از روی سیستم کامل پاک کنم
این دستور sudo apt-get remove اجرا کردم ولی کامل پاک نشد
سیستم عامل توزیع backbox معماری x64 بر پایه اوبونتو ۱۲.۰۴
ممنون از کمکتون
« آخرین ویرایش: 15 آذر 1392، 05:43 ب‌ظ توسط faramarz42 »

آفلاین POo

  • Full Member
  • *
  • ارسال: 180
  • جنسیت : پسر
  • 12.04, debian testing
پاسخ : حذف کامل نرم افزار از روی سیستم
« پاسخ #1 : 13 آذر 1392، 01:09 ق‌ظ »
سلام
در کل سرچ بفرمایید یا از دستور man استفاده کنید
ولی ... اگر از طریق apt نصبش کردین یا پکیج بوده یعنی خودتون از سایتی جایی نگرفتین:
  sudo apt-get --purge remove {package}
اینم لینک:
http://www.cyberciti.biz/howto/question/linux/apt-get-cheat-sheet.phpاز man هم استفاده کنید  ;)
پدرم روضه رضوان به دو گندم بفروخت     ناخلف باشم اگر من به جوی نفروشم

آفلاین x

  • High Sr. Member
  • *
  • ارسال: 561
  • جنسیت : پسر
پاسخ : حذف کامل نرم افزار از روی سیستم
« پاسخ #2 : 13 آذر 1392، 01:30 ق‌ظ »
سلام دوست عزیز
از طریق apt نصبش کردم ولی نمیدنم چرا کامل پاک نمیشه با این دستور ها امتحان کردم ولی پاک نشد و ارور داد

sudo apt-get purge wine\*

sudo apt-get --purge remove wine

apt-get remove wine*
اینم ارورش

E: Error, pkgProblemResolver::Resolve generated breaks, this may be caused by held packages

ممنون

آفلاین POo

  • Full Member
  • *
  • ارسال: 180
  • جنسیت : پسر
  • 12.04, debian testing
پاسخ : حذف کامل نرم افزار از روی سیستم
« پاسخ #3 : 13 آذر 1392، 08:16 ق‌ظ »

E: Error, pkgProblemResolver::Resolve generated breaks, this may be caused by held packages

خواهش میکنم، ببینین شما فکر کنم کل ارور رو نزاشتین مثلا یک چیزی شبیه این لینک نیست؟
http://askubuntu.com/questions/382285/problem-while-removing-package-from-ubuntu-13-10
Some packages could not be installed. This may mean that you have
 requested an impossible situation or if you are using the unstable
 distribution that some required packages have not yet been created
 or been moved out of Incoming.
 The following information may help to resolve the situation:

The following packages have unmet dependencies:
 libatk-wrapper-java : Depends: default-jre but it is not going to be installed or
                            java2-runtime
                   Recommends: libatk-wrapper-java-jni but it is not going to be installed
E: Error, pkgProblemResolver::Resolve generated breaks, this may be caused by held packages.

اول نوشته ":The following packages have unmet dependencies" بعد هم گفته ":Recommends" الان مشکل اینه که برنامه میگه اصلا این پکیج درست نصب نشده باید اینجوری باشه در واقع شما یا باید اون unmet dependencies رو درست کنید که چندتا روش داره که تو این لینک ها هست.
http://askubuntu.com/questions/140246/how-do-i-resolve-unmet-dependencies

یکی دیگه پیشنهاد کرده با aptitude این کار انجام بشه اگر apt مشکلی در install نداره امتحانش کنید:
http://askubuntu.com/questions/382298/e-error-pkgproblemresolverresolve-generated-breaks-while-uninstalling-mono

یک روش دیگه هم با استفاده از dpkg اول با این دستور ببینین پکیج های وابستش چیاست:
dpkg -p {package}
بعد با دستور زیر به زور remove کنید اما این دستور احتمال خراب کاری داره چون هیچ هشداری نمیده و همه چیو پاک میکنه باید با دستور بالا چک کنید که پکیج های وابستش چیا هستن و اگر پکیج مهم توش نبود ... (با اینکه تو ویکی دبیان اینو گفته اصلا توصیه نمیکنم):
dpkg --force-all --remove {package}اینم لینکش:
https://wiki.debian.org/DebianPackageManagement

و یک مورد دیگه هم که میشه امتحان کرد این دستور هست که در واقع تا جایی که بشه remove میکنه و اگر چیزی هم بمونه در کار پکیج منیجر ها اختلالی ایجاد نمیشه و نادیده گرفته میشه.dpkg remove−reinstreq --remove {package}
پدرم روضه رضوان به دو گندم بفروخت     ناخلف باشم اگر من به جوی نفروشم

آفلاین POo

  • Full Member
  • *
  • ارسال: 180
  • جنسیت : پسر
  • 12.04, debian testing
پاسخ : حذف کامل نرم افزار از روی سیستم
« پاسخ #4 : 13 آذر 1392، 08:32 ق‌ظ »
اینم یک لینک درون انجمنی، اتفاقی پیداش کردم:
http://forum.ubuntu.ir/index.php/topic,71842.0.html
پدرم روضه رضوان به دو گندم بفروخت     ناخلف باشم اگر من به جوی نفروشم

آفلاین x

  • High Sr. Member
  • *
  • ارسال: 561
  • جنسیت : پسر
پاسخ : حذف کامل نرم افزار از روی سیستم
« پاسخ #5 : 13 آذر 1392، 11:35 ب‌ظ »
سلام دوست عزیز
این دستور رو اجرا کردم اینم خروجی

ronika@ronika-Aspire-5734Z:~$ dpkg remove−reinstreq --remove wine
dpkg: error: need an action option

Type dpkg --help for help about installing and deinstalling packages
  • ;

Use `dselect' or `aptitude' for user-friendly package management;
Type dpkg -Dhelp for a list of dpkg debug flag values;
Type dpkg --force-help for a list of forcing options;
Type dpkg-deb --help for help about manipulating *.deb files;

Options marked
  • produce a lot of output - pipe it through `less' or `more' !

ronika@ronika-Aspire-5734Z:~$

آفلاین Amir (شفقی)

  • High Hero Member
  • *
  • ارسال: 1734
پاسخ : حذف کامل نرم افزار از روی سیستم
« پاسخ #6 : 14 آذر 1392، 12:05 ق‌ظ »
اول همون دستور remove  رو دوباره امتحان کن با این تفاوت که شماره ورژن  رو هم اضافه کن. مثلا به جای 1.5 ورژن که نصب کردی رو بنویس.


sudo apt-get --purge remove wine1.5
نشد اینو تست کن

sudo apt-get purge wine\*
« آخرین ویرایش: 14 آذر 1392، 12:10 ق‌ظ توسط Amir (شفقی) »

آفلاین POo

  • Full Member
  • *
  • ارسال: 180
  • جنسیت : پسر
  • 12.04, debian testing
پاسخ : حذف کامل نرم افزار از روی سیستم
« پاسخ #7 : 14 آذر 1392، 12:49 ق‌ظ »
سلام ببخشید من دستور رو اشتباه گفتم ظاهرا! اینجوریه فکر کنم:dpkg --remove-reinstreq {package} از man دیدم. امیدوارم درست باشه
این کاری هم که امیر جان گفتن رو انجام بدین.
این دستور هم پکیج های نصب شده رو بر میگردونه(grep هم که یک جور فیلترِ):dpkg --get-selections | grep wineبا پایپ کردن grep کاری کردم که هرچی اسم wine  توش داره رو برگردونه.
-------
aptitude رو امتحان کردین؟
--------
این لینک درون انجمنی رو هم نگاه کردین دیگه، در واقع اومده همون unmet dependencies رو برطرف کرده. به صورت خلاصه بگم توی اون لینک پست سومم و لینک هایی که تو پست دومم دادم این مشکل رو اینجوری حل کردن:apt-get -f installالبته اون لینک ها مفصل تر گفتن، بعدش هم با apt یا dpkg این پکیج wine رو remove کنید.
« آخرین ویرایش: 14 آذر 1392، 01:04 ق‌ظ توسط POo »
پدرم روضه رضوان به دو گندم بفروخت     ناخلف باشم اگر من به جوی نفروشم

آفلاین x

  • High Sr. Member
  • *
  • ارسال: 561
  • جنسیت : پسر
پاسخ : حذف کامل نرم افزار از روی سیستم
« پاسخ #8 : 14 آذر 1392، 01:42 ق‌ظ »
سلام دوستان
همون دستور امیر خان پاک کرد

sudo apt-get --purge remove wine1.4
با شکر از شما دوستان